The new 17 " repros are pretty decent although if your going to use them daily/during the winter you may find you have problems with the laquer and paint peeling. They have the advantage of already being in 5 X112 so no worries about switching to Porsche brakes or spacers. For £600 you are heading into genuine Fuch territory but at that price they'd probably need a refurb anyway.
Ive seen a few of these fitted and they look well Smile

you need to have a peep at this list to see which ones will fit.

911 Fuchs Wheel Data

Size       Offset      Backspacing   Part #
4.5x15...42mm.....100mm...........901.361.012.01
5.5x15...42mm.....112mm...........901.361.012.04
6 x 15....36mm.....112mm...........901.361.012.06
7 x 15....49mm.....138mm...........901.361.012.05(R)
7 x 15....23.3mm..112mm............911.361.020.41
8 x 15....10.6mm..112mm............911.361.020.42
9 x 15....3mm......117mm............911.361.020.03
6 x 16....36mm.....112mm...........911.362.113.00
7 x 16....23.3mm..112mm............911.362.115.00
7 x 16....23.3mm..138mm............951.362.115.00(944)
8 x 16....10.6mm..112mm............911.362.117.00
8 x 16....23.3mm..125mm............951.362.117.00(944)
9 x 16....15mm.....130mm...........911.362.118.00

 
only the 7 x 15  et 49 have the correct or enough offset

I noticed you said you are new to the whole T3 thing.  For info if it's 17s your after and a cheap fix without looking shit get some Mercedes wheels.  I picked up a set of 17s off ebay for £100.  They are off a 500SLK and were 5x112 et 35 so fit perfect.  All you have to do is is run a larger drill bit through each hole to take the larger VW bolts. 
 
Bonus is they are genuine Mercedes german quality and not made from monkey metal.
